Navigating International Regulatory Hurdles
When new technologies emerge, they rarely respect the invisible lines drawn on maps by modern nations. A device developed in one jurisdiction might easily cross borders, making it difficult for local laws to remain effective. Imagine trying to manage a shared river where some people dump waste while others try to filter the water for drinking. Without a unified set of rules, the people who work to keep the water clean will eventually lose their battle against the pollution. This economic analogy shows that technology, like water, flows wherever it finds the path of least resistance. If one nation creates a loose regulatory environment, it often forces other nations to lower their own standards to stay competitive. This race to the bottom creates a dangerous cycle where safety often takes a backseat to rapid growth and industrial speed.
Key term: Global governance — the collective management of international affairs by states and organizations to ensure stability across borders.
International bodies currently struggle to find a common language for these fast-moving technological developments. Because every nation values its own sovereignty, they are often hesitant to sign agreements that limit their ability to innovate. This tension creates a fragmented landscape where citizens in different countries experience drastically different levels of protection and access. Some regions might prioritize individual freedom above all else, while others might focus on state-led control to ensure social harmony. These conflicting values make it nearly impossible to draft a single treaty that satisfies every major global power. Without a shared ethical framework, international cooperation often breaks down into small, ineffective groups that fail to address the larger systemic risks to humanity.
Barriers to Worldwide Regulatory Consensus
Achieving a consensus on how to handle powerful tools like neural enhancement is a massive, ongoing challenge. Nations often disagree on the fundamental purpose of these technologies, which leads to deep mistrust during diplomatic talks. If one country views a brain chip as a human right, but another views it as a security threat, they start from opposite ends of the spectrum. This disagreement is not just about the technology itself, but about the very nature of human identity and social order. To bridge these gaps, international organizations must identify shared goals that transcend specific national interests or cultural backgrounds.
| Challenge Type | Description of the Barrier | Impact on Global Policy |
|---|---|---|
| Sovereignty | Nations guard the right to set their own internal laws | Slows down global treaties |
| Economic | Countries compete for technological dominance | Encourages risky development paths |
| Ethical | Vast differences in cultural views on humanity | Prevents universal moral standards |
These challenges are not insurmountable, but they require a level of transparency that currently does not exist in global politics. When leaders prioritize short-term gains over long-term human safety, they undermine the trust needed to build robust international institutions. To move forward, we must develop mechanisms that allow for flexible regulation while maintaining strict safety standards. This might involve creating independent bodies that monitor technological progress regardless of which country hosts the research. By focusing on the shared risks of advanced technology, nations might find common ground that encourages responsible innovation instead of reckless competition.
True global governance requires nations to align their diverse ethical values toward a shared framework for human safety.
